In Matthew 24 Jesus own Disciples asked Jesus for the Sign of His Coming and Jesus responded to their question with such Truth in Matthew 24 and 25.

Jesus said this.
Mat 24:29 Immediately after the tribulation of those days shall the sun be darkened, and the moon shall not give her light, and the stars shall fall from heaven, and the powers of the heavens shall be shaken:
Mat 24:30 And then shall appear the sign of the Son of man in heaven: and then shall all the tribes of the earth mourn, and they shall see the Son of man coming in the clouds of heaven with power and great glory.
Mat 24:31 And he shall send his angels with a great sound of a trumpet, and they shall gather together his elect from the four winds, from one end of heaven to the other.

The Disciples asked for the sign and Jesus gave them the sign.

Jesus said when He is Coming and He himself said it will be after the signs are seen in the sky after the Tribulation has ended.

Jesus even goes on to say that of that day of His coming which He has already told us will be after the Tribulation know man knows the day (24 hour Period) or Hour (60 minute Period).

We know that His Coming is after the Tribulation has ended but we do not know the day or hour.

Jesus then tells us to learn a Parable of the Figtree.

Mat 24:32 Now learn a parable of the fig tree; When his branch is yet tender, and putteth forth leaves, ye know that summer is nigh:
Mat 24:33 So ((likewise)) ye, when ye shall see all these things, know that it is near, even at the doors.

Jesus said that when we see ALL THESE THINGS then we know that His Coming is Near, even at the Doors.

We have as a Generation not seen ALL these things as He has described yet, not at all.

Jesus even told the Disciples when the Great Tribulation begins. It is when the Abomination takes place in the middle of the week.

Jesus even told us of all the events that will be seen before the Tribulation ends from verses 6 to 28

In verse 25 Jesus even says Behold I have told you so beforehand.

Jesus takes the time to tell us what will happen before the day of His coming

Jesus has prophesied it and it will take place exactly as He Prophesied.

There is not one verse where Jesus Prophesies that He is Coming before or even in the middle of that Great Tribulation, no not one.

Jesus told us exactly when He will Come and it is somewhere in the days after the Tribulation has ended.

In Mark we know that Jesus says that there exists a short period of time from when the Tribulation has ended until the signs are seen in the sky.
Jesus says (those days after that Tribulation)

After means after, days mean days.

Mar 13:24 But in those days, after that tribulation, the sun shall be darkened, and the moon shall not give her light,
Mar 13:25 And the stars of heaven shall fall, and the powers that are in heaven shall be shaken.
Mar 13:26 And then shall they see the Son of man coming in the clouds with great power and glory.
Mar 13:27 And then shall he send his angels, and shall gather together his elect from the four winds, from the uttermost part of the earth to the uttermost part of heaven.

Many ignore what Jesus has to say in regards to when He is Coming as if they know better and even say that Jesus can come at any moment.

Jesus told us clearly when He is Coming but of that Literal Day or that Literal Hour that He comes after the Tribulation no man knows.

BUT Jesus said that when we see all those things then He is at the door and then is the Time our Redemption draws near.

Again we have not seen all these things yet.

Matthew 24:44 Therefore you also be ready, for the Son of Man is coming at an hour you do not expect.

That is exactly the problem. On one hand Jesus SEEMS to say when He will return. But he ALSO says he will come at an hour you do not expect.

If he was talking about his second coming in the Olivet Discourse, we would be able to "see the signs" and know the hour he is coming back. But he also says when he comes it will be unexpected.

Which is why I don't think he was talking about his 2nd coming in the Olivet Discourse but rather his coming on the clouds in judgment when Jeruslem, the temple and the Jewish system was destroyed.

I would agree with you totally if Jesus said the following words

But of that day and hour of my coming before the tribulation no man knows.

But Jesus did not say those words, quite the opposite.

In Matthew 24 verse 36 Jesus very clearly stated But of That Day.

In the Greek That word is a Demonstrative Pronoun and virtually means (that very same, self same day)
This implys that Jesus is talking about the Day of His Coming which He spoke about in verses 29-31

Jesus is not making reference to any other day, He is very clearly talking about the Day of His Coming which takes place sometime after the signs are seen in the Sky and that is sometime after the Tribulation has completely ended which we know is only 3 and a half years long.

We know that Jesus is talking about that Coming as He states this in verse 37 making reference to That Day Of His Coming, which is the very question the Disciples asked.

Jesus even instructs us to learn a parable regarding trees and that when summer is near the trees start to bud, Do we know the exact day summer starts NO but the signs are truly seen with the eye. Jesus did not say that Summer starts as soon as the buds start, Jesus said that Summer is near when you see the signs.

LIKEWISE Jesus said when we see all these signs we know that He is at the Door and we know our Redemption is near and we Know to Look Up. Jesus did not say that that was the Day, He said it is near and at the Door.

Do we still know the Day or Hour NO
But we do know that once (all) His Prophesied events are fully seen then we really need to watch as it can then happen at any day

Jesus even tells us when to look up and when He is at the Door.

All of Matthew 25 is talking about THAT very same Day of His Coming which He so clearly stated would happen after the Tribulation has completely ended.

1. All raptured Christians receive their glorified bodies (Romans 8:22,23; and 1 Corinthians 15:50-54).
2. There are no children born to glorified bodies. (Matthew 22:23-30
3. All unsaved are cast into Hell before the 1,000 Year Kingdom Reign of Christ. (Revelation 19:11-21 and Matthew 25:41)

Quote by Dr. Younce;

""If the Rapture is post Tribulation, several problems arise with impossible solutions. Where do the mortal bodies come from of those that are born during the Millennium and rebel at the conclusion of the Millennium? (Revelation 20:7-10). There would be no lost people alive to have children, so they cannot come from them. All of the saved have their glorified bodies. No children can be born to them as a result of a Post Tribulation Rapture Remember; at the end of Christ’s 1,000 Year Reign there are unbelievers who will give their allegiance to Satan in an attempt to defeat Christ. (Revelation 20:7-10). How would they get their human bodies? Placing the Rapture at the end of the Tribulation and the start of the Millennium makes an impossible situation. At the Rapture all Christians have their glorified bodies, which do not produce human beings. All the lost are cast into Hell at the end of the Tribulation Period. Therefore, the philosophy of a Post-Tribulation Rapture is impossible.
